#54cd53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54cd53 is composed of 32.9% red, 80.4%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.5%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 119.5 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 56.5%. #54cd53 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ffa6 with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#54cd53
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a03 is the darkest color, while #fafef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#54cd53
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f918f is the less saturated color, while #2af828 is the most saturated one.
